  • We went to Le Croix du V.P. in the May mid term break in 2013.

    You also need to factor in the local tax for visitors. Not very expensive, but still another expense.

    The cost of the ferry is over and above the cost of the holiday, as are the toll gate charges.

    And the cheapest tickets I could find for Disneyland itself were £50 per person for a 1 day ticket, and 12 year olds and older have to pay the same price as adults. Tesco no longer seem to have Disneyland Paris in their clubcard offers.

    Although there is no daily service charge as there is for the UK parks, linen is extra at Le Croix du V.P.
